The Isle of Man's first ultra-rapid public electric vehicle charger is being installed at the Sea Terminal.
The new charger is capable of delivering up to 160kW to a single vehicle and forms part of Manx Utilities' ongoing investment in the Island's public EV charging network.
Once operational, the site will retain its existing charger, increasing overall capacity to four charging bays.
Demand for public charging continues to grow, with 476 charging sessions recorded across Manx Utilities' public charging network over the past week.
